MEETING NOTICE

Lehigh County, in cooperation with Pennsylvania Department of Conservation and Natural Resources (DCNR), Bureau of Forestry, and the USDA Forest Service are developing efforts to control gypsy moth caterpillars.  Primary areas of concern:  certain Lehigh County residential and “high use” public space in the northern tier.

A public meeting concerning GYPSY MOTH CONTROL will be held at the Germansville Fire Company

August 6 from 7:00-9:00 PM. *DCNR staff will be present to explain the control 

All interested property owners are encouraged to attend this meeting.  Applications for the “Spring 2016 Control Program” will be available.  Any questions, please contact:
